Two reactions were studied with three varieties of starch granules from maize, wheat, and rice. In Reaction-I, the granules were reacted with 1mM ADP-[ 14 C]Glc and in Reaction-II, a portion of the granules from Reaction-I was reacted with 1mM ADP-Glc. Two mechanisms are recognized for polysaccharide chain elongation: (a) the nonreducing-end, primer-dependent mechanism and (b) the reducing-end, two-site insertion mechanism. We recently demonstrated the latter mechanism for starch biosynthesis by pulsing starch granules with ADP-[ 14 C]Glc and chasing with ADPGlc for eight varieties of starch granules.
